SYMPTOM:
After installing and trying to use Strategy Office 9.4.1, the user does not see the Strategy tab in the ribbon bar of Microsoft Office 2010 applications, as demonstrated in Excel below:

If the user attempts to rectify this issue by going to Strategy Office Configuration, navigating to "General", and checking the "Load in Excel" option, as seen below, the setting is not retained the next time the user opens Strategy Office Configuration.

This same scenario may also be seen for PowerPoint and Word.
CAUSE:
One cause of this issue is a faulty installation process that results in the required registry keys not being created. This can be verified by taking the following steps:
